The senior waste and radiation protection specialist will play a key role in providing radiation protection advice and training to support a range of operational projects, such as site investigations, land remediation, drain surveys and waste assay campaigns. In addition, they will provide radioactive waste support in terms of Waste Management Plans, Best Available Technique (BAT) Assessments and Sample and Analysis Plans.
Desired profile
As a Senior Waste and Radiation Protection Specialist, your role will include:
- Provision of radiation protection advice that will ensure working practices meet the requirements of current Legislation and best practice.
- Evaluate the operational environment and the radiological requirements to provide Radiation Risk Assessments (RRA) for the work in hand.
- Advise teams on operational styles that should be adopted to maintain a safe working environment and provide training, as appropriate.
- Co-ordinate the production of radiological protection documentation such as Normal Operational Dose Uptake Assessments, Radiological Zoning, Radiological Risk Assessments, ALARP Assessments, Operating Instructions and compliance statements.
- Develop and maintain knowledge of the characterisation and land quality core services and capabilities.
- Engage with regulatory authorities to support Permit applications, transfers and variations.
- Provide guidance, advise and training to customers regarding HSE notifications and registration, typically required for land remediation contracts on historic sites, i.e., thorium and radium contamination.
- Provide transport RRA’s for radioactive waste and source transfers
- Write technical reports and support characterisation assessments and desk studies.

Qualifications and Experience
To be considered for the Senior Waste and Radiation Protection Specialist role:
We are seeking a highly motivated individual, possessing strong communication and interpersonal skills. The following criteria will also be considered:
- RPA2000 Certified Radiation Protection Adviser is essential
- Demonstrable experience as a qualified Radiation Protection Adviser (RPA) in operational environments.
- Experienced in the technical aspects of waste management and land remediation, including regulatory requirements, and working towards or qualified as a Radioactive Waste Adviser (RWA) would be advantageous.
- Experienced in collaborative delivery, working closely with clients, regulators and stakeholders.
- Must be able to achieve and maintain Security Clearance (SC) for this role.
- A bachelor’s degree in a science related field would be beneficial.
- Ability and willingness to acquire job related knowledge through self-development and learning from others
Must have a full driving licence and be available to visit customer sites, as required.
